Waste Heat Recovery System Market Overview: Unlocking Energy Efficiency

In today’s energy-conscious world, industries are seeking smarter, more sustainable ways to operate. One innovation making significant strides is the Waste Heat Recovery System (WHRS)—a technology that captures and reuses excess heat produced by industrial processes. This approach not only saves energy but also reduces emissions and operating costs.

🔧 What is a Waste Heat Recovery System?

Waste Heat Recovery Systems are designed to capture heat that would otherwise be lost in exhaust gases, cooling water, or other heat-generating processes. This recovered heat is then reused for power generation, heating, or mechanical work, significantly improving overall energy efficiency.

🌐 Key Market Segments

  1. By End-Use Industry: Oil & Gas, Cement, Chemical, Automotive, Food & Beverage, Metal Manufacturing

  2. By Application: Pre-heating, Steam Generation, Electricity Generation

  3. By Technology: Regenerators, Recuperators, Heat Exchangers, Waste Heat Boilers, Organic Rankine Cycle (ORC)

🔮 Market Trends and Drivers

  • Decarbonization Efforts: Growing push for net-zero emissions is accelerating demand for WHRS.

  • Industry 4.0 Integration: Smart sensors and AI-based energy monitoring are enhancing recovery system efficiency.

  • Retrofitting Opportunities: Aging infrastructure presents opportunities for retrofitting with WHRS technology.

🌱 Environmental Impact

Implementing WHRS significantly cuts CO₂ emissions and energy waste. For industries that are heavy energy consumers, this is a critical step toward sustainability and regulatory compliance.
